Which location describes the setting of "tennessee's partner"?

In the mid-nineteenth century, the friendship of the two men in the short story took place at the Sandy Bar. It was a foundation established in Calaveras County, California by the gold miners. It emphasizes the development of the characters while they are in the California gold camp.

Every time the grandmother told The Misfit that he "did not have common blood," she was trying to ______.
aliina [53]
Every time the grandmother told The Misfit that he "did not have common blood," she was trying to save her own life. This statement is taken from "A Good Man is Hard to Find" story written by Flannery O'Connor in 1953 about a grandmother and a serial killer named Misfit. This statement is said by the grandmother to manipulate "The Misfit" when "The Misfit" attempted to kill her family and her.
